STREET STOCKS RETURN TO THE MIDWEST

by | Nov 24, 2023 | SSA Street Stocks, WA

Official Release Courtesy of Speedway Sedans Western Australia.

It has been 13 years since the Speedway Sedan Australia’s biggest division by numbers has had a major event in the Midwest of Western Australia. Still, Street Stocks will return to the Geraldton City Speedway this weekend for round two of the Odh Mechanical Tri-City Series.

In a nomination list that looks more like a who’s who of Street Stock racing in the State, the division’s return could be one for the memory bank.

Current series leader Matthew Iwanow is sadly absent from this weekend’s list due to being on holiday. Still, it leaves the door open for plenty of other drivers to put themselves in the box seat for the $4,500 overall points win.

The one who is in the prime position is Jamie Oldfield. After losing last year’s Overall Championship in the final race, he is looking to be on the upper hand this time. Oldfield was also in attendance last time Street Stocks had a major event at the track, along with Hayden Norman.

At the time, Norman was just out of his Junior Sedan career; this time around, with a State Title now to his name, he is gearing up to head back to his old stomping grounds.

The only local in the field, Peter Dowie, will love the fact for the first time, he will be able to defend home turf, and after a strong run at the opening round, Dowie could be a dark horse to watch out for.

Speaking of a dark horse, Collie’s Cody Avins will continue to be a driver who could upset the apple cart again. The opening-round winner is sitting pretty and is back for another chance at going back-to-back.

Adding to that list, State Champion Jake Hoath, Carnarvon combo Jace Kempton and Damon Lyall, Matt Hammond, who is a purple patch of form down south, Australia 2 Ben Norman, Blake Iwanow and the Dellar brothers, Kayne and Lachie are all just a tiny piece of drivers who have a shot at taking out the second round.
